* ``set_tess_state`` configures the default tessellation parameters:
* ``default_outer_level`` is the default value for the outer tessellation
levels. This corresponds to GL's ``PATCH_DEFAULT_OUTER_LEVEL``.
* ``default_inner_level`` is the default value for the inner tessellation
levels. This corresponds to GL's ``PATCH_DEFAULT_INNER_LEVEL``.
